The Newport Mansions

by RACCOON1

Touring the Newport Mansions is the big thing in Newport , Rhode Island .

The mansions were owned/build by American industrialists in the late 1800's .

There are twelve mansions open for viewing . Some are not open year round and some are cloesed on specific days .

Do not worry about this as taking a look at two should do.

The number one mansion is "Breakers" built by Cornelius Vanderbilt II .

At the Newport Visitor Centre in the center of the city you can purchase various types of packages.

The " Breakers Plus Package "
( $21 (US) in 2002) gets you in to The Breakers and one other property .

Budget 1.5 hours per house . There are guided tours or you can go on your own with an audio cassette. The mansions are mostly located on Bellevue Avenue . After your tour(s) head south on Bellevue until you hit Ocean Drive and follow it around the coast line back to the center of Newport .

Support history, become a member.

by Herkbert

Something to consider before heading to Newport is to become a member of the Preservation Society Of Newport County. Becoming a member helps to support the preservation of the various mansions; it also provides you with some benefits that will be useful during your trip. As a member, you get free admission into the various mansions. In addition, you also get front of line privileges - which is great when the crowds are in full force.

And another thing, your membership donation is tax deductible.

Newport Cliff Walk

by Tom_Fields

Walking along these gorgeous seaside cliffs provides spectacular views of the seashore and of the impressive mansions of many of New England's rich and famous. Anyone who saw the movie Reversal of Fortune (about Klaus von Bulow, the doctor accused of poisoning his wife) will recognize this place.

Thames Street (shopping, eating, partying)

by mpm189

You can't really say you've been to newport until you have gone down to Thames Street. This is where most of the bar/clubs, restaraunts and shops are. This is in my opinion the highlight of newport. In the summer time the crowd is pretty crazy. This area runs along the western coast of the island and is the heart of downtown Newport. If you're looking for a party in mid summer, this is the place to be. But be forwarned of the prices. This is not a cheap place to go out. Most bars/clubs in the summer have a $10 minimum at the door and a cheap beer could run you $4 a glass. A great time, but could put a hole in your wallet if it's not budgeted for.
